alien Posted October 14, 2012 Report Share Posted October 14, 2012 Check out the starting point from the ST company to macritchie. The signboard state tht 7.2 km to macritchie and 1.6 km to the tower. There is also signboard state tht 4.4km to bt timah nature from the ST company point. Actually not consider very far to macritchie, only 3km more if compared hiking to bt timah nature from the same point. abang Posted September 7, 2013 Author Report Share Posted September 7, 2013 For those who rarely do outdoor activities, I recommend a walk up Mt. Faber from Harbour Front MRT. Walk up the steps and walk towards Henderson Wave. Exit from there and walk towards SAFRA Mt. Faber.The entire walk is about 45 mins but if you rarely exercise, this is a good activity for 1st timer. alien Posted September 11, 2013 Report Share Posted September 11, 2013 i think it's along the rifle range route... the starting point was from the forested area near the canoe-ing area, quite clear directions from there... so that means it would be impossible to find the 'entrance' again?... haiz... ... the henderson-hortpark walk does sound do-able...U mean clear direction from macritchie to rifle range rd? After u reached the rifle range rd, if u walk down somewhere along the rd, u need to walk towards a big open grass area, the entrance into the bt timah nature path is somewhere located along there. There is actually two entrance tht u can get into bt timah nature. If u get the wrong direction at the open grass area, u wld end up walking into entrance lead to diary farm park.
